The Board Management Software Market is poised for significant expansion, with an anticipated market size reaching USD 6.066 billion by 2035. This growth represents a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.22% from 2024, reflecting the increasing adoption of digital governance tools among organizations globally. As companies navigate complex regulatory environments and remote working conditions, software solutions designed for board management have become indispensable. Technological advancements, coupled with evolving governance needs, have further propelled this market forward, indicating a robust future outlook for stakeholders and investors alike. Currently, the Board Management Software Market is characterized by a competitive landscape that features companies like Diligent (US), BoardEffect (US), Azeus Convene (PH), and OnBoard (US). These firms are leading the charge in providing cutting-edge solutions that streamline communication and documentation for governance. The rise of cloud-based platforms, in particular, has made these tools more accessible and affordable for businesses of all sizes. As remote governance continues to gain traction, the demand for such software is only expected to increase, making it vital for companies to differentiate themselves in a crowded marketplace. Notably, while North America remains the largest market, the Asia-Pacific region is emerging as a dynamic player, driven by rapid digital transformation initiatives. Several key drivers are fuelling the growth of the Board Management Software Market. Firstly, the ongoing shift towards remote work has necessitated innovative solutions for maintaining board effectiveness and communication. Organizations are increasingly seeking platforms that can support virtual meetings, document sharing, and compliance management. Additionally, as regulatory requirements evolve, businesses are turning to technology to ensure they meet governance standards. This trend reflects a growing awareness of the importance of compliance in today’s corporate environment. Conversely, challenges remain, particularly in terms of data security and integration with existing systems, which can hinder adoption among more traditional organizations. Effective risk management and user-friendly design are essential to overcoming these barriers.

A geographical analysis reveals significant disparities in market growth. North America is predicted to maintain its dominant position, primarily due to established players and high investment in technology solutions. The market size in this region is bolstered by a strong emphasis on corporate governance and compliance practices. However,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to exhibit the fastest growth rate, reflecting an increase in digital initiatives and a push towards modern governance frameworks. Local companies are also gaining ground, developing tailored solutions that cater to regional governance needs. The expansion of board management software in emerging markets suggests a promising future outlook for stakeholders willing to invest in these regions.

 AI Impact Analysis

Artificial intelligence is set to revolutionize the Board Management Software Market by enabling smarter decision-making processes. AI-driven tools can automate administrative tasks, analyze large volumes of data, and provide predictive insights that help boards make informed decisions. For instance, AI can analyze meeting outcomes and suggest best practices for future meetings, thus driving efficiency. Furthermore, machine learning algorithms can enhance security measures by identifying unusual patterns in data access and usage, protecting sensitive governance documents from breaches. As AI technologies continue to advance, their integration into board management software solutions will become a key differentiator in the market.
